The chemical structure of 2,2-Bis(4-carboxyphenyl)hexafluoropropane is key to its utility. It features two carboxyl groups attached to phenyl rings, which are further linked by a hexafluoroisopropylidene group. This fluorinated segment contributes significantly to the thermal stability, oxidative resistance, and low dielectric constant of polymers synthesized using this monomer. This makes it an indispensable ingredient for applications demanding extreme performance, such as in high-temperature resistant films, advanced composites, and specialized coatings. A primary application for 2,2-Bis(4-carboxyphenyl)hexafluoropropane lies in the synthesis of high-performance polymers like polyoxadiazoles and polytriazoles. These heterocycle-containing polymers are renowned for their excellent thermal and chemical resistance, making them ideal for aerospace, defense, and electronics industries. Furthermore, this compound serves as a valuable ligand in coordination chemistry. Its rigid structure and functional groups allow it to coordinate with transition metal ions, leading to the formation of novel coordination compounds and metal-organic frameworks (MOFs). These materials are at the forefront of research in areas such as gas adsorption, catalysis, and chemical sensing.
